Full job descriptionScience Graduate Teaching Assistant - St. Albans
Location: St. Albans
Salary: £95- £120 per day (depending on experience)
Contract Type: Full-time, Term-time only
Start Date: September 2026
Overview
We are recruiting a Science Graduate Teaching Assistant to support teaching and learning across Biology, Chemistry, and Physics within a secondary school.
Key Responsibilities
*Support Science lessons across KS3-KS5
*Assist in practical experiments and laboratory sessions
*Deliver targeted intervention sessions to small groups and individuals
*Help prepare laboratory equipment and ensure health and safety compliance
*Support teachers in tracking student progress and attainment
Requirements
*A degree in Biology, Chemistry, Physics, or a related Science subject
*Strong subject knowledge across scientific disciplines
*Good organisational and communication skills
*Enthusiasm for working with young people in education
*Lab or school experience is desirable but not essential
Benefits
*Ideal pathway into teacher training (PGCE, School Direct, etc.)
*Hands-on classroom and laboratory experience
*Training and ongoing school support
